Abstract

A number of studies have been conducted on the diffusion of mobile commerce, its challenges, opportunities, issues and obstacles. However, few have emphasized on its adoption within Middle East countries. This paper reviews the current literature in order to assess the mobile commerce adoption in Arab countries within Middle East and identify the key success factors in mobile commerce adoption in them.
